In case you missed Michelle and Jesse’s split:
In March, USmagazine.com revealed the couple separated “after nearly six years of marriage.” They share 3-year-old daughter Isabella Bunny, who was born in April 2020.
Jesse explained what fans would see on season one of Bravo TV‘s The Valley. โThereโs a major story line about our life where I try to work on myself throughout the entire summer to be the best version of myself. If the best version of myself aligned with the best version of herself, then our marriage would make it. People evolve. If your marriage and relationship doesnโt evolve with it, it will never work no matter how bad you want it.โ
